I'm trying to get a fixation-point in the center of the screen when displaying movies.  The movies are presented on left, right and center of the monitor.  No matter what I do the fixationpoint always disapears for a shorter while between the different stimulus onset.  I've tried to add a text on top of the movie, but it is impossible to get the fixpoint to stay infront, the video is always played infront, and therefore the fixationpoint is lost.  Becasue EPRIME2 isn't able to run movie files shorter than 160ms we had to add some white background behind each stimulus so that the movie lasts for 1000 ms instead of the shorter lenght.  Of this reason it is important that the fixationpoint is placed on top of the movie, otherwise the screen will be blank for a shorter while after eacn stimulus onset in the center of the monitor.

You can make a fixation movie and place it on top of your movie, using the Slide object.
